During the Boston Marathon, a certain runner averages running 25 miles in 5 hours. What are the unit rates for this situation? (How far can they run in 1 hour and how long does it take to run 1 mile?)

If a certain runner averages running 25 miles in 5 hours, then

25miles = 5hrs

To determine how far they can run in 1 hour, then;

X = 1hr

Divide both expressions

25/x = 5/1

5x = 25

X = 5miles

Hence the runner can run 5miles in an hour
